AWAITING GUARANTEES

- BLOOMBERG

Major US oil executives expressed caution about President Donald Trump’s push for them to spend at least $100 billion to rebuild Venezuela, with the head of Exxon Mobil Corp. calling the nation currently “uninvestable.” Trump convened nearly 20 industry representatives in the White House on Friday and predicted they could come to an agreement “today or very shortly thereafter” to reinvigorate operations in the oil-rich Latin American country.
